🔥 SGX's bitcoin and ether perpetual futures are now open to U.S. institutions

The Singapore Exchange (SGX) has obtained CFTC authorization to open its crypto perpetual futures to U.S. institutional investors, a milestone the exchange says bridges American trading desks with Asian liquidity pools.

"Under the Regulation 48.10 ruling, we have obtained CFTC authorization to open our crypto products to U.S. institutional access. Previously, U.S. participants couldn't trade these contracts but now they can," — KC Lam, head of crypto derivatives at SGX Group, said.


🔜 Regulation 48.10 is the framework under which the U.S. Commodity Futures Trading Commission allows a registered Foreign Board of Trade (FBOT), an overseas exchange recognized by the CFTC, to give U.S. participants direct access to its trading system, without the exchange needing to separately register as a full U.S.-regulated exchange.

In effect, it lets qualifying foreign platforms open their existing order books to U.S. institutional traders under CFTC oversight, rather than requiring a new, standalone U.S. listing. 🚀

🍎 Apple Watch’s new AI features are normalizing the idea that technology is always listening

At Wednesday’s Surprise and Shine event, the real surprise wasn’t the foldable iPhone, but Apple’s decision to let its watches process live audio and transcribe conversations. With its new watches’ “Audio Intelligence,” “Live Rewind,” and “Siri Recap” features, the company is straddling the line between accessibility and utility on one side and what starts to feel like invasive technology on the other.

On its own, Audio Intelligence seems to be a useful feature for the deaf or hard of hearing, as it can alert Apple Watch wearers to sounds like sirens, alarms, doorbells, babies crying, and more, using on-device AI. This can work even when the wearer’s iPhone is not with them and, in some cases, could provide life-saving assistance, such as when a fire alarm or carbon-monoxide detector goes off.

Apple’s data protections may help, but normalizing listening technology could still be a questionable move for a privacy-conscious company. 🤔

🇰🇷🇺🇸 South Korea Nears Agreement on Billions in U.S. Investments, a Win for Trump

The South Korean government is nearing the announcement of a major energy investment project in the U.S. to support America’s artificial-intelligence build-out, a long-awaited development of the trade deal struck between Washington and Seoul last year. The deal, potentially worth more than $100 billion, envisions South Korea financing the construction of up to eight nuclear power plants and a natural-gas project.

🪰 A Simulated Fruit Fly Brain Is Now Trading Crypto

Coinbase programmer Alex Wormuth connected a digital model of a fly’s brain to a trading simulator. The system is based on a scientific map of the fly’s brain containing roughly 139,000 neurons and 50 million connections.

Here’s the wild part: there’s no AI agent and no pre-built trading strategy. Market events are translated into stimuli that the simulated brain can understand: buying is perceived as “sugar,” while selling is perceived as “bitterness.” Neural activity is then converted into commands to buy or sell cryptocurrencies.

"I gave the fly brain $100 to trade bitcoin. Dopamine neurons are stimulated when the fly makes profit. Neuron activity controls buy/sell decisions and makes trades on coinbase. Will the fly get rich?" - Alex Wormuth wrote.


This isn’t Wormuth’s first experiment — he previously used a simulated fly brain to play Doom.

⚡️💳 Introducing the MoneyGram Card: Giving Customers More Freedom to Use Their Money, Wherever Life Takes Them

MoneyGram today launched the MoneyGram Card, a stablecoin-backed card designed to serve eligible customers worldwide. The card gives customers more freedom and flexibility with their money: the ability to hold a stable-dollar balance, access cash when they need it, or spend anywhere Visa is accepted, online, in stores and across borders.

🔜 For everyday spending, customers can add the MoneyGram Card to Apple Wallet or Google Wallet to tap-to-pay, checkout faster and shop online. To access cash, customers can transfer themselves funds from their MoneyGram balance and pick up local currency at a nearby MoneyGram location.

🔘Developed in partnership with Rain, the enterprise-grade infrastructure for stablecoin-powered payments, the card gives customers a stable-dollar balance they can hold and use for everyday spending within the MoneyGram ecosystem.

🔘The card brings together Rain's card infrastructure, Crossmint's wallet capabilities, and the Stellar network to provide fast, simple and immediate access to funds.

❗️The MoneyGram Card is available today in Colombia, with plans to expand to more global markets in the coming months.

MoneyGram plans to expand the experience with a physical card option in late 2026, giving customers the ability to withdraw cash at ATMs and make in-person purchases in places where digital cards may not be as widely accepted. 🚀

⚡️🧑‍⚖️ New Clarity Act text tweaks DeFi, credit union provisions, but road ahead for bill remains murky

A new version of the Digital Asset Market Clarity offers tweaks to how the key crypto legislation would address activities by DeFi firms and some traditional finance firms engaging in crypto activities.

This latest aspirational draft of the bill includes provisions on when DeFi projects would need to register with the CFTC and get Bank Secrecy Act requirements, makes clear that the DeFi language is only meant to target spot-market and cash transactions in digital commodities (and not prediction markets) and gives credit unions more clarity on their rule with digital assets.

"We have incorporated more than 114 separate provisions at my Democrat colleagues' request, and as a result, this bill is a strong bipartisan product," — said Republican Senator Cynthia Lummis, one of the bill's chief negotiators.

"Unlike rulemaking, legislation gives this industry a lasting solution that shields it from the whiplash of changes in the White House. Since the CFTC and SEC will write rules on digital assets with or without the Clarity Act, I believe a lasting, bipartisan compromise is the best route for America's future." 🇺🇸


The cloture vote, scheduled for Tuesday, Sept. 15, will require 60 Senators to support the bill to succeed.

🤖 Anthropic says it blocked misuse of its AI that could have supported biological weapons

Anthropic has blocked efforts by bad actors to use its AI models for malicious activity such as cyberattacks, surveillance, and research that could have led to biological weapons.

As AI models grow more powerful, elaborate cyberattacks no longer require sophisticated skills and even lone individuals can create threats that would not have been possible even a year ago. Anthropic has added stronger safeguards in its latest models to restrict biological research that could also be used to make weapons.

“The cases we share here aren’t typical misuse, but rather examples of the most notable and novel threat activity we’ve identified to date,” — Anthropic said in its third report since March 2025 describing AI misuse.


📝 The report includes snippets of the malicious code and AI prompts Anthropic said it found, and urges governments and AI competitors to identify and prevent similar abuse.

🇺🇸 Newsom signs online kid safety laws, including rules backed by Sam Altman

Gov. Gavin Newsom greenlit sweeping new child safety rules for social media and AI chatbots, including a law backed by OpenAI CEO Sam Altman. The laws will establish what Newsom described as nation-leading guardrails designed to shield young people from potential risks associated with unchecked social media and AI use.

SB 1119 🔜 requires AI chatbots to verify users’ ages, limits kids’ exposure to inappropriate content and restricts AI companies’ ability to advertise to minors.

AB 1709 🔜 will ban social media companies from offering children under 16 access to personalized feeds — also known as “For You” pages — as well as other features designed to maximize screen time, like infinite scrolling and video autoplay. It still allows kids to use social media platforms if those features are deactivated.

AB 2 🔜 threatens fines of up to $1 million per child in cases where tech platforms are found liable for fostering anxiety, depression or other child harms. The bill also triples payouts in certain cases where courts find children or families are owed significant damages, meaning companies could be forced to pay more than $1 million.

In total, Newsom approved 13 laws relating to youth online safety and privacy Thursday.

🇷🇺 Russia's top mobile providers launch first commercial 5G networks in 16 cities

Russia's largest mobile service providers — Mobile TeleSystems (MTS) , Vimpelcom , MegaFon and T2 — have put their first 5G networks into commercial operation, the Digital Development Ministry reported. In this first phase the 5G services have become available in 16 cities that are home to 10 million people.

All users with Android devices will soon be able to use 5G services in these cities. Access to 5G for iPhone users "depends on the decisions of the Apple corporation," the ministry said. Work is underway on launching the technology in another 50 cities before the end of 2026.

🧠 Injectable nanodevices could provide effective treatment for drug-resistant glioblastoma

The brain cancer glioblastoma is one of the most aggressive and treatment-resistant cancers known to medicine, carrying a median survival of just 12-15 months, even with the best available care.

Now, researchers at the MIT Media Lab have developed injectable nanoantennas, each about one-hundredth the width of human hair, that can be magnetically activated to create localized therapeutic electric fields that target and kill brain cancer cells without damaging healthy brain tissue.

📝 Using cells derived from this tissue in the laboratory, the researchers demonstrated that HITMAN eliminated 52.2% of these drug-resistant cancer cells — more than five times than that achieved by the standard chemotherapy drug temozolomide (TMZ) — while leaving healthy neurons and brain-supporting astrocytes unharmed.

“In laboratory and animal studies, this approach significantly reduced tumor growth and extended survival without detectable side effects, highlighting its potential as a precise and safe brain cancer therapy,” — says Deblina Sarkar, associate professor and AT&T Career Development Chair at the MIT Media Lab.

🇨🇦Canada’s OSFI Confirms Tokenized Deposits Equal Traditional Bank Funds

Canada’s banking regulator has sent one of the strongest signals yet that blockchain-based bank money can fit into the current banking system.

🔘The Office of the Superintendent of Financial Institutions (OSFI) said tokenized deposits aren’t legally different from regular deposits, so the tech used to represent them doesn’t create a whole new legal category on its own.

🔘OSFI focuses on what a financial product is, rather than how it’s built or delivered. Therefore, a bank deposit doesn’t turn into a different kind of financial product just because it’s tracked as tokens on a blockchain.

❗️That distinction could clear a big obstacle for Canadian banks wanting to experiment with blockchain-based payments and treasury tools.

However, this isn’t a free pass for every blockchain product, as OSFI said federally regulated banks still have to follow all relevant laws and rules, including its requirements around technology risk, cyber risk, and third-party risk.

Banks should also check in with their OSFI supervisor before launching anything new.

🥽 Polish developer builds app that detects nearby Meta smart glasses

Polish software developer Paweł Szydłowski, developed an iPhone app called Zuckoff that detects nearby Meta smart glasses and estimates their distance after seeing videos of people using the devices to secretly film and identify unsuspecting strangers, amid growing privacy concerns.

The app scans Bluetooth signals from nearby devices and checks them for identifiers linked to known models of smart glasses. Its main scanning screen shows users the estimated distance of nearby smart glasses, while a paid version can run in the background and send notifications when compatible glasses are detected.
